A new series of benzamido alkyl naphthols were synthesized from the multi-component reaction of 4-(3′-methylthioureido)benzamide, aromatic aldehydes and 2-naphthol. Molten tetrabutyl ammonium bromide was used as a very efficient medium for this reaction while the use of common organic solvents gave no or poor yields. This method is an interesting instance of using molten salt as a medium in multicomponent reactions.
